Implementing an AI-enabled accounting system can transform traditional accounting into a streamlined and efficient process.

Benefits of AI-enabled Systems:

Streamlined Processes:
Automate repetitive tasks like data entry, invoice processing, and reconciliations to reduce manual labor.

Continuous Data Capture:
Use AI to automatically capture and categorize transaction data from various sources.

Error Reduction:
Leverage AI algorithms to minimize human errors in data entry and calculations.

Predictive Analytics:
Use machine learning to identify patterns and anomalies, improving data reliability and forecasting trends.

Instant Reporting:
Generate real-time financial reports and dashboards that provide up-to-date information.

Dynamic Analytics:
Analyze trends and generate insights for timely decision-making.

Data-Driven Decisions:
Equip stakeholders with actionable insights derived from AI analysis for strategic planning.

Scenario Analysis:
Utilize AI for modeling different financial scenarios and forecasting future performance.

Regulatory Compliance:
Implement AI to monitor transactions for compliance with regulations and identify potential issues.

Fraud Detection:
Use machine learning algorithms to detect unusual patterns and flag potential fraudulent activities.

Cloud Integration:
Facilitate remote access and collaboration among team members through cloud-based platforms.

Operational Efficiency:
Reduce costs associated with manual processing and errors through automation.

Resource Optimization:
Free up staff for higher-value tasks, reducing the need for additional personnel.

Key Considerations

When choosing an accounting system, consider factors such as:

Business Size

Small, medium, or large enterprises.

Industry

Specific needs based on the sector.

Features

Invoicing, payroll, inventory management, etc.

Budget

Subscription costs vs. one-time purchases.

Scalability

Ability to grow with your business.

Each of these systems has its pros and cons, so it’s important to evaluate them based on your specific requirements.
